Donald Jr.'s obituary
It is with great sadness that the McQueen family announces the passing of their beloved son, brother, father, grandfather, and uncle, Donald Kenneth "Donnie" McQueen Jr., on March 15, 2025. After a long battle with illness following an accident in September 2023, Donnie is now at peace.
Born on September 5, 1956, Donnie was a gifted Red Seal painter who dedicated many years of service to BC Ferries. He was well respected by his co-workers and known for his strong work ethic and craftsmanship.
Donnie will be remembered dearly by all, for his infectious smile that could light up any room and a distinctive laugh that was truly one of a kind. His presence brought joy to those around him, and his absence leaves an immeasurable void in the hearts of all who had the honour of knowing him.
Donnie is predeceased by his mother, Doreen (2013), and his brother Ronnie (1987), whom he is now reunited with.
He is survived by his father, Donald Sr. “Max”; his son Dean (Soffia); daughters Misty and Kaitlyn; six grandsons; his brother Lonnie (Staci); sisters Heather (the late Albert), Kim (Roger), Bambi (Milan), Cindy (Carlos), Holly (the late Arthur), and Tammy; as well as numerous nieces, nephews, great-nieces, great-nephews, cousins, and cherished lifelong friends.
Among those who held a special place in Donnie’s heart was his loyal dog and best friend, Chewy.
